Embark on a cultural and historical tour from Bucharest to Târgu-Jiu and Hobița, exploring the life and works of Constantin Brâncuși, Romania's most famous sculptor. Your journey begins in Bucharest, and heading towards Târgu-Jiu. Here, in the tranquil town that inspired Brâncuși, you’ll visit his monumental sculptural ensemble dedicated to the heroes of World War I. Discover The Table of Silence, The Gate of the Kiss, and the iconic Endless Column—masterpieces that symbolize the passage of time, love, and infinity, each with deep philosophical significance and intricate craftsmanship. After exploring these famous sculptures, you’ll continue your journey to Hobița, a serene village nestled in the foothills of the Carpathian Mountains. Here, you’ll visit the birthplace of Constantin Brâncuși, where his humble beginnings are preserved in a charming traditional house. The village offers a glimpse into Brâncuși’s early life and the rural landscape.

The Saxon villages appeared in Transylvania around the XVIIIth century when the Hungarian kings settled here German colonists. Their cultural identity was preserved thanks to the multitude of crafts and traditions despite the constant threat of the Ottoman Empire. Thus, the Saxons formed a strong community in Transylvania and managed to protect their land by creating fortifications around their churches. Nowadays, among 150 medieval fortified churches, 7 are part of UNESCO world heritage.
